Output 081565653cae6183a0ad30e6593d71289b4b6b820421cebab160f3c006129d9d: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5a6b65e152b781dcad5d5fb6e7ee88b57c68fff OP_EQUALVERIFY OP_CHECKSIG
address
1HZV26obbEiJbY9RsKPrMbnE4BkcPkgfK9
transaction
081565653cae6183a0ad30e6593d71289b4b6b820421cebab160f3c006129d9d
spent
true